Employment Opportunities for Mothers of Disabled Children at Sharva Shiksha Abhiyan Day Care Centers at Coimbatore District
Journal Title: International Journal of Research in Social Sciences - Year 2017, Vol 7, Issue 11
Abstract
Women’s empowerment in India is heavily reliant on many different variables that include environmental location, educational condition, social status and age. Policies of women empowerment exit at the national, state and local levels in numerous sectors, including health, education, economic opportunities, gender violent behavior and political contribution. However, there are large gaps between policy advancements and actual practice at the community level. As such, women and girls have constrained mobility, right of entry to education, access to health facilities, lower decision making authority and brutality. Political involvement is also stuck at the Panchayat level and at the state and national levels, despite existing reservations for women. Women who have education they have higher decision making power in the household and the community. Moreover the level of women’s education also has a direct inference on maternal mortality rates, nutrition, and health indicators among children. Empowerment makes women to take decisions in her family and support to the society, according to the statement the research study focused on mothers who have physically or mentally impaired children they are not able to live their life happily like other mothers who have normal children in this view what are the thing can support the disabled children’s mothers to have to become little satisfied of their children’s improvement. During my preliminary study I found that SSA day care centers are providing working opportunity to a mother who has disabled child by analyzing the economic condition whose financial condition is poor that mother gets an opportunity with full work training. They provide free courses for mothers at SSA day care centers. The study conducted in Coimbatore city focused on SSA day care centers. There are 1787 SSA day care centers are in Coimbatore district consist of 12 blocks it consists 229 villages. Sarcarsamakulam was selected through lottery method for the study it contains eight villages and 56 SSA day care centers. Data was collected through interview schedule method from all the 56 respondents in SSA day care centers. The study reveals result as all respondents are benefited by the SSA, 32 per cent of respondents economically independent, 67 per cent of respondents are satisfied in the job profile given by SSA, 82 percent of respondents are comfortable with their children in SSA day care center and 29 percent of respondents aware about the government schemes and polices for disabled children through the employment.
